Pana softball wins first regional game

(PARIS) — The Pana High School softball team scored 4 runs in the top of the third inning to take a 5-0 lead over the Paris Tigers and held on to win, 5-4. It was the first round of the Teutopolis Class 2A Regional on Monday night.

In the third, Pana loaded the bases and Joey Laker cleared them with a double for 3 RBI’s. The Panthers had a half-dozen hits in the game. Shelby Ashcraft and Brianna Mathis each had 2 hits and each had a pair of RBI’s. Izzy Reed also had a base hit.

The Tigers cut into the Panthers lead, 5-1 with a run in the fourth, then scored 3 runs in the bottom of the fifth to close the gap to 1, 5-4.

Ashcraft came in to relieve in the fifth to get the save for Pana.

Laker started the game for Pana. She gave up 4 runs on 5 hits and struck out 2. She was the winning pitcher. Ashcraft came in, throwing 2-and-2/3rds innings, She allowed 3 hits while striking out 4 and giving up 2 walks.

Pana improved to 12-11 on the season and weather-permitting, they are heading to T-Town Tuesday afternoon to face the number 1 seed in the regional, Effingham St. Anthony. First pitch is at 4:30 p.m.
